The Goodall Cup is the championship trophy of the Australian Ice Hockey League. This has only been so since 2000; it was previously a traditional inter-state tournament. With it having first been awarded in 1909, it makes it the fifth oldest ice hockey trophy in the world, after the Stanley Cup, the Queen's Cup, the Boyle Cup and the Allan Cup. New South Wales is by far the most frequent winner of the Cup, with 37 titles; since the Cup has become the AIHL's championship trophy, the Newcastle North Stars are the most titled team with four titles; the Sydney/Penrith/AIHL Bears have three titles.
